Company Overview

This review is for the South Carolina (formerly, Madison, Indiana) company called Card Payment Solutions. If you are looking for the Santa Barbara, California-based company, see the CardPayment Solutions (California) review.

Global Payments/First Data/TSYS Reseller

Card Payment Solutions (CPS) is a small to mid-size merchant account provider that began operations in 1999. The company is a sales organization that acts as a reseller for several direct processors including Global Payments, First Data (now Fiserv), and TSYS. Although Card Payment Solutions is a reseller, it handles the customer service of its accounts directly. In addition to conventional merchant accounts, the company also offers a zero-fee processing program.

Card Payment Solutions Payment Processing

Card Payment Solutions processes all major debit and credit cards for most business types. Their services include EMV card readers and swipers, POS solutions, mobile payments, ATMs, online ordering, customer engagement, and e-commerce solutions.

Mobile Payment Processing by Card Payment Solutions

For businesses that need flexibility in transaction locations, Card Payment Solutions offers mobile payment processing. This service enables businesses like outdoor vendors, home service providers, and event organizers to accept and process debit and credit card payments using a mobile device. This feature enhances the convenience of transactions and expands the reach of the business.

E-Commerce Services Provided by Card Payment Solutions

In recognition of the growing trend of online shopping, Card Payment Solutions offers a reliable e-commerce payment processing service. They provide a secure online payment gateway that facilitates the efficient handling of online transactions, fulfilling the needs of businesses operating in the digital marketplace.

Card Payment Solutions' Virtual Terminal Services

For businesses dealing primarily with mail orders or phone orders, Card Payment Solutions' virtual terminal service is an invaluable feature. It allows businesses to manually enter card details into a secure online system, providing a flexible solution for remote payment processing.

Integrated Business Management Tools from Card Payment Solutions

Besides their payment processing capabilities, Card Payment Solutions offers integrated software solutions aimed at streamlining various aspects of business operations. Their suite of tools covers areas like payment processing, inventory management, CRM, and data analysis. By providing these integrated services, Card Payment Solutions aids businesses in enhancing their overall operational efficiency.

Location & Ownership

Card Payment Solutions is headquartered at 514 2nd Loop Rd Ste A, Florence, South Carolina 29505-2848, and is an ISO/MSP of Wells Fargo Bank, N.A., Concord, CA. Dan Christopher is listed as the president of Card Payment Solutions.

Clarifying Complaints

Card Payment Solutions shares a similar name with another merchant account provider, leading to confusion in online complaints. Most grievances seem directed towards the California-based company rather than the Indiana/South Carolina-based Card Payment Solutions covered here.

Common Complaint Themes

Common grievances in negative Card Payment Solutions reviews include high or unexpected fees, difficulties in canceling services, and unresolved problems. While these complaints are scattered and not indicative of consistent issues, they highlight challenges in resolving merchant concerns promptly.

Legal and Regulatory Issues

No class-action lawsuits or FTC complaints have been found against Card Payment Solutions. Dissatisfied clients seeking recourse can consider reporting concerns to relevant supervisory organizations.

Card Payment Solutions Fees, Rates & Costs

A Closer Look at The Contract

Cost & Fees Summary
Cancellation Penalties Yes
Monthly & Annual Fees Unclear
Processing Rates 1.00% - 4.99%
Equipment Leasing Yes

Three-Year Contract

Card Payment Solutions’ merchant account pricing appears to be influenced by the type of business, its processing volume, and the agent handling the account. According to an agent from the company, there’s a standard 36-month service agreement with yearly automatic renewals. To terminate the service, clients must notify the company 60 days before the contract expires. Additionally, there’s a possibility of incurring a Liquidated Damages early termination fee if the service is canceled during the contract. These terms, as mentioned by the agent, are negotiable.

It is noted that Global Payments, First Data, and TSYS often include long-term, noncancelable equipment leases in their contracts, which could result in higher costs for merchants. Since Card Payment Solutions resells services from these providers, similar equipment lease terms might be present in their agreements.

No Contract Complaints

While the presence of a Liquidated Damages clause and automatic renewal might typically lead to a lower rating, Card Payment Solutions hasn’t attracted the usual complaints associated with these practices. This could indicate that the company either seldom enforces these policies or tends to reach amicable resolutions in disputes. However, business owners should thoroughly review and understand the agreement terms before signing, and, if possible, negotiate the removal of any Liquidated Damages clauses.

Zero-Fee Processing Program

The zero-fee processing program by Card Payment Solutions adds a 3.99% surcharge on all credit card transactions, which offsets the credit card processing fees typically borne by the business. Under this plan, merchants are said to only pay a fixed monthly fee, as transaction fees are passed to customers. This model is increasingly popular, but business owners should verify that no additional one-time or annual fees are applied besides the monthly fixed fee.

Outside Sales Team

Card Payment Solutions appears to rely heavily on recruiting outside independent resellers to market and sell its merchant services. Generally, this practice results in numerous complaints because providers cannot control the sales and marketing tactics of the resellers. As of this update, however, we have located few negative Card Payment Solutions reviews, which may indicate that its policies do not allow price gouging. The company’s use of resellers will not negatively affect its score unless evidence surfaces to the contrary.

This compares favorably to our list of best credit card processors.

No Deceptive Quotes

Card Payment Solutions does not prominently list any rate quotes or guarantees that could be considered misleading. As of this update, the company is strongly promoting its cash discount program, which adds a 3.99% surcharge to each customer’s total in order to reimburse the client for the cost of processing a credit card. These programs are becoming increasingly common within the industry, and Card Payment Solutions’ promotion of this pricing model doesn’t raise any red flags. If you suspect that Card Payment Solutions is adding hidden fees to your contract, however, we recommend seeking a third-party statement audit.

Our Card Payment Solutions Review Summary

Our Final Thoughts

Card Payment Solutions of South Carolina rates as a promising credit card processing company in that it has very few complaints in comparison to other companies of similar size and time in business. The company can improve its rating by offering month-to-month contracts with no cancellation fees.
